Transaction 83379d7c3149ed083a260fa341a39dc184ad50348f15f7c58971859113d6263b

631 Input
2 Outputs
  • 83379d7c3149ed083a260fa341a39dc184ad50348f15f7c58971859113d6263b:0
  • value  1000003
    address  1FCHKfnrm87x6MFUdUchebWzYucW6PHaDJ
  • 83379d7c3149ed083a260fa341a39dc184ad50348f15f7c58971859113d6263b:1
  • value  2500000000
    address  3MvWkcGcpo3W1yxWNfZpsrqg5Mh8NcoL6x